Hernia Types and Why You Need Expert Surgical Help
There are different types of hernias such as inguinal, umbilical, femoral, incisional, and hiatal. Most hernias develop due to weakness in the abdominal wall, which may be present at birth or caused by aging, injury, or surgery. The discomfort caused by a hernia may start small but usually worsens with time, requiring surgical intervention. FAQs
Q1. What is the role of anesthesia during hernia surgery?
Anesthesia is used to ensure the patient feels no pain during the procedure. Depending on the type and complexity of the surgery, general, spinal, or local anesthesia may be administered. The anesthesia team carefully monitors vital signs and adjusts medication to keep the patient comfortable and safe throughout the operation.
Q2. Is hernia surgery a major operation?
While hernia surgery is common and often minimally invasive, it can still be considered a significant procedure depending on the type and size of the hernia. The complexity of the case, the patient’s age, and overall health are all taken into consideration before choosing the surgical method.
Q3. What complications can arise from hernia surgery?
Although hernia surgeries are generally safe, potential complications can include infection, bleeding, recurrence of the hernia, or reactions to anesthesia. These risks are minimized when the surgery is performed by experienced surgeons in a well-equipped hospital.
Q4. Are hernias treatable without surgery?
In most cases, surgery is the only effective way to repair a hernia. Non-surgical treatments may help manage symptoms temporarily but do not resolve the underlying issue. Delaying surgery can lead to complications such as hernia strangulation or obstruction.
Q5. How do I prepare for hernia surgery?
Patients are advised to stop eating or drinking several hours before surgery. They should also inform the medical team about any medications, allergies, or previous surgeries. Preoperative tests may be conducted to ensure the patient is fit for surgery.
Q6. Can elderly patients safely undergo hernia repair?
Yes, with proper evaluation and support, elderly patients can safely undergo surgery. A detailed medical assessment helps the clinical team plan the safest approach and manage any existing health conditions during and after the procedure.
